Before diving into the manual, it's important to understand the textbook it accompanies. Norman E. Dowling's Mechanical Behavior of Materials: Engineering Methods for Deformation, Fracture, and Fatigue is a respected, comprehensive text that introduces the full spectrum of material behavior. It emphasizes practical engineering methods for testing structural materials, predicting their strength and fatigue life, and preventing failure. The text is designed for upper-level undergraduate and graduate courses in mechanical engineering and materials science. Mechanical Behavior Of Materials Solutions Manual Dowling
